Hey Everyone,
Well I thought I would pop on and give everyone a quick update on what's been happening. Since the last time I wrote which was right after our race in North Carolina, not a whole lot has been happening. A couple good things are in the works though and im really excited, yet nervous for the "real" season to start. I did another local TT race in Parkesburg, PA on May 4th. My dad worked on the track and helped them build it all in a couple days time. Sure enough, it was pretty awesome, but rough and dusty. We had a pretty good turnout with 20 or so expert riders. I just didn't have what it took to win on this day and I finished 2nd in both classes. My holeshots weren't the usual and I just wasn't riding the right lines and being smooth. 2nd is usually a pretty good day, but I was disappointed. There's always next time. Chris Carr once told me to "turn your good days into wins and your bad days into top fives". Other then that, I have started to work out with an awesome fitness trainer at the gym named Brian Beddow. I used to put in a good workout but now im putting in above the bar workouts each time I go in and I can already tell a difference. He is making a huge difference in my racing career and helping me continue to the next step. We got a big race this weekend in Sedalia, MO and then were heading to Springfield, IL to test on the TT! I wanted to give get well wishes to my good buddy Nichole Cheza (nicholecheza.com) who crashed last weekend at a test in Monticello, NY. Get well 15! Thanks to everyone who has been supporting me this year. It means alot and only makes me want to continue to work harder.
